Why Live in Lone Grove

Lone Grove, Oklahoma is a rural community in southern Oklahoma and the Chickasaw Nation, known for its large acreages and ranch properties. Homebuyers are drawn to the area for its expansive plots, ranging from 2 to 50 acres or more, ideal for farming and ranching. The landscape features tall grass plains, crop fields, and stands of oak, hickory, and maple trees. Housing options include ranch-style houses, cottages, manufactured homes, and larger ranching estates, with limited new construction. Residents should be aware of the above-average tornado risk and consider storm shelters and solid insurance coverage. Sullivan Park offers local recreation with a playground, sports courts, and picnic areas, while Ardmore Regional Park, less than 10 miles away, provides walking trails, a fishing pond, disc golf, a skate park, and more. Lake Murray State Park, also around 10 miles from town, features boating, fishing, swimming, trails, golf, stables, and an ATV area. Highway 70 serves as the main thoroughfare, connecting Lone Grove to Interstate 35 and nearby Ardmore, about 7 miles away, where residents find additional amenities like big-box stores, chain groceries, and a wider dining scene. Local eateries in Lone Grove include El Mexicano and Boomerang Diner, with more options available in Ardmore. Seasonal events such as Christmas on the Farm and the Ardmore Festival of Lights, along with Chickasaw Nation celebrations in nearby Tishomingo, add community features. Major air travel is accessible at airports in Oklahoma City and the Dallas–Fort Worth area, roughly 100 miles away.
